There are only 3 real downsides to the E85. One is availability. The second is that you need alot more injector which adds to the initial cost and complexity of the fuel system. and thus gets way shittier gas mileage. Last but not least is shelf life in the tank so you cant run it in a car that sits for most of the time unless you drain it. Other than that, you can't lose. correct on the 600ish whp depending on the trans and such. Ive ran E85 on my stock longblock 6.0L, BW S475 turbo 4l80 car. Was running around 11-12psi and 14* timing with no intercooler on pump gas, switched to E85, dual intank walbros, big lines and 65# injectors, base pressure at around 65psi. Got up to 16psi and 19* timing with no intercooler when the injectors maxed out at 94%. That was (est.) around 660whp. Was running about 72% on gas with a 50psi base pressure. That was (est.) around 540whp. Also the winter blend argument is pretty moot, the colder weather (a good 30-40 degrees in most parts of the country) makes up for the decreased ethanol just fine. I ran the E70 up here in MN and had no problems maintaining the same boost and timing, but i backed the boost down anyway since the power was unusable on the cold roads. 160# injectors will go to around 1050-1100whp on a stalled auto, you can get a little more with more pressure but i dont recommend pushing them that hard.
